Helios RXPA is a silicon IP targeted for ARM® based System on Chip (SoC) solutions. It is designed for high throughput low latency applications that require regular expression (RegEx) pattern matching. Helios RXPA is an ARM® co-processor for next generation cloud and network appliances. It is a unique, fully scalable, hardware accelerated solution for Security Analytics Acceleration (SAA) and content processing. The solution can be tuned for the desired combination of throughput, rule depth and complexity.
Features
- Scalable bandwidth for 5G to 200G
- Supports up to 1 million rules using external DDR3/4
- Supports POSIX/PCRE compatible regular expressions
- Comprehensive Software Development Kit (SDK) including:
- RXP compiler
- Application Programming Interface (API)
- Reference applications
- Utilities
- Interfaces: AXI or Native
- Run-time full and partial ruleset update
